Flashing the ECU is normally the first step for standard or lightly modified bikes. Normally they will have ECU setting for standard mods like yours.


The rev limit can normally be raised, fueling altered, limits removed in the lower gears, ignition timing altered, activate quick shifter settings (if present), alter the modes (if present), emissions settings altered etc.
